Located in St Paul's Collegiate School Hamilton:
St Paul's Collegiate School is one of New Zealand's premier independent day and boarding schools for Year 9-13 boys and Year 11-13 girls.
With a growing roll of currently 800 students, our school offers a learning environment that fosters academic achievement, extracurricular involvement, character education, and traditional values.
We are seeking a non-residential House Coordinator (Matron) to join our girls boarding house, which accommodates around 70 Year 1- Year 13 girls.
With 330 boarding students living across four houses (three boys' houses and one girls' house), we offer a welcoming and supportive community.
A busy and rewarding role, the House Coordinator ensures the boarding house operates effectively, and that standards are maintained.Responsibilities include urgent repairs to uniforms, monitoring boarders' health, hygiene and cleanliness, sorting laundry, labeling clothes, driving students to medical appointments, and liaising with cleaning, laundry, maintenance and health clinic staff and the Housemaster.
This hands-on role requires flexibility, strong time management and organisational skills, and good communication skills.As an adult presence and role model in the House, the House Coordinator acts as an adult listener, go-to person, and supervisor and needs to develop strong relationships with the girls and provide support to other House staff.
This is a part-time, hourly paid position working Monday to Friday (approximately 1.30 pm pm), when boarders are onsite (approximately 40 weeks per year).
We are looking for someone to start this role at the commencement of the 2024 school year (though hours during Term 4 may be available).
